openedx / edx-ora2

Open Response Assessment Suite
GNU Affero General Public License v3.0
61 stars 196 forks source link

Open Response Assessment |build-status| |coverage-status|

This repository defines an Open Response Assessment (ORA) XBlock for use within edx-platform: https://github.com/openedx/edx-platform

User docs <http://edx.readthedocs.org/projects/edx-partner-course-staff/en/latest/exercises_tools/open_response_assessments/index.html>_

Installation, Tests, and other Developer Tasks

If you'll be modifying ORA code, the Open edX Developer Stack_ is a Docker-based development environment.

edX engineers follow the guides on our wiki <https://openedx.atlassian.net/wiki/spaces/EDUCATOR/pages/9765004/ORA+Developer+Guide>_. Reading this page before contributing is highly recommended.

.. _Open edX Developer Stack: https://github.com/openedx/devstack

License

The code in this repository is licensed under version 3 of the AGPL unless otherwise noted.

Please see LICENSE.txt for details.

How to Contribute

Contributions are very welcome. The easiest way is to fork this repo, and then make a pull request from your fork. The first time you make a pull request, you may be asked to sign a Contributor Agreement.

Reporting Security Issues

Please do not report security issues in public. Please email security@openedx.org

Mailing List and Slack

You can get help with this code on our mailing lists or in real-time conversations on Slack.

.. _mailing lists: https://open.edx.org/getting-help .. _Slack: https://open.edx.org/getting-help

.. |build-status| image:: https://github.com/openedx/edx-ora2/workflows/Python%20CI/badge.svg?branch=master :target: https://github.com/openedx/edx-ora2/actions?query=workflow%3A%22Python+CI%22 :alt: CI build status .. |coverage-status| image:: https://coveralls.io/repos/edx/edx-ora2/badge.png?branch=master :target: https://coveralls.io/r/edx/edx-ora2?branch=master :alt: Coverage badge